
Apple has announced that it will be opening Europe’s first Apple Developer Center later this year and has provided a sneak peek inside the facility.
Situated in Berlin, Germany, it will be the company’s fifth developer center after Cupertino, Shanghai, Singapore, and Bengaluru …
The centers are designed to provide developers with training programs and hands-on support from Apple experts.
The company says workshops and one-on-one sessions will be offered for those at every stage of app development, and businesses of all sizes from one person up.
Apple also has a global network of 19 Apple Developer Academies that provide longer-term training to selected candidates.
It’s not yet known when the Berlin Center will open, but you can see additional photos or renders below. While it mostly looks like a very stylish space, the classroom does appear inexplicably basic …
